Synopsis of Commencer à méditer
En este libro, Thich Nhat Hanh nos ofrece una guía clara y concisa para crear un espacio de calma y paz en nuestras vidas, a través de la práctica de la meditación en el hogar. El autor aborda aspectos esenciales como la respiración, la postura y la alimentación, mostrando cómo la contemplación y la meditación pueden transformar nuestra vida, trayendo paz y alegría duraderas.

Thích Nhất Hạnh
Thích Nhất Hạnh was a Vietnamese Thiền Buddhist monk, peace activist, prolific author, poet, and teacher, who founded the Plum Village Tradition, historically recognized as the main inspiration for engaged Buddhism. Known as the "father of mindfulness", Nhất Hạnh was a major influence on Western practices of Buddhism.
